Spring Security 6带来了几个重大变化,包括移除类、弃用方法以及引入新方法。
从Spring Security 5迁移到Spring Security 6可以逐步进行,不会破坏现有的代码库。此外,我们可以使用第三方插件如OpenRewrite来促进迁移到最新版本。
在本教程中,我们将学习如何将使用Spring Security 5的现有应用程序迁移到Spring Security 6。我们将替换弃用的方法,并利用lambda DSL简化配置。此外,我们将利用OpenRewrite使迁移更快。
Spring Boot基于Spring框架,Spring Boot的版本使用Spring框架的最新版本。Spring Boot 2默认使用Spring Security 5,而Spring Boot 3使用Spring Security 6。
大约 6 分钟